RE: [RFC] lib/st_ring: add single thread ring

2023-09-05 Thread Konstantin Ananyev
> > > Add a single thread safe and multi-thread unsafe ring data structure. > > > This library provides an simple and efficient alternative to > > > multi-thread safe ring when multi-thread safety is not required. > > > > Just a thought: do we really need whole new library for that? > > From wha

RE: [RFC] lib/st_ring: add single thread ring

2023-09-04 Thread Honnappa Nagarahalli
nd > Subject: RE: [RFC] lib/st_ring: add single thread ring > > > > > Add a single thread safe and multi-thread unsafe ring data structure. > > This library provides an simple and efficient alternative to > > multi-thread safe ring when multi-thread safety is not

RE: [RFC] lib/st_ring: add single thread ring

2023-09-04 Thread Konstantin Ananyev
> Add a single thread safe and multi-thread unsafe ring data structure. > This library provides an simple and efficient alternative to multi-thread > safe ring when multi-thread safety is not required. Just a thought: do we really need whole new library for that? >From what I understand all we

RE: [RFC] lib/st_ring: add single thread ring

2023-08-26 Thread Honnappa Nagarahalli
> > > From: Mattias Rönnblom [mailto:hof...@lysator.liu.se] > > Sent: Thursday, 24 August 2023 12.53 > > > > On 2023-08-24 10:05, Morten Brørup wrote: > > >> From: Honnappa Nagarahalli [mailto:honnappa.nagaraha...@arm.com] > > >> Sent: Tuesday, 22 August 2023 07.47 > > >> > > >>> From: Morten Br

RE: [RFC] lib/st_ring: add single thread ring

2023-08-24 Thread Morten Brørup
> From: Mattias Rönnblom [mailto:hof...@lysator.liu.se] > Sent: Thursday, 24 August 2023 12.53 > > On 2023-08-24 10:05, Morten Brørup wrote: > >> From: Honnappa Nagarahalli [mailto:honnappa.nagaraha...@arm.com] > >> Sent: Tuesday, 22 August 2023 07.47 > >> > >>> From: Morten Brørup > >>> Sent: Mo

Re: [RFC] lib/st_ring: add single thread ring

2023-08-24 Thread Mattias Rönnblom
On 2023-08-24 10:05, Morten Brørup wrote: From: Honnappa Nagarahalli [mailto:honnappa.nagaraha...@arm.com] Sent: Tuesday, 22 August 2023 07.47 From: Morten Brørup Sent: Monday, August 21, 2023 2:37 AM From: Honnappa Nagarahalli [mailto:honnappa.nagaraha...@arm.com] Sent: Monday, 21 August 20

RE: [RFC] lib/st_ring: add single thread ring

2023-08-24 Thread Morten Brørup
> From: Honnappa Nagarahalli [mailto:honnappa.nagaraha...@arm.com] > Sent: Tuesday, 22 August 2023 07.47 > > > From: Morten Brørup > > Sent: Monday, August 21, 2023 2:37 AM > > > > > From: Honnappa Nagarahalli [mailto:honnappa.nagaraha...@arm.com] > > > Sent: Monday, 21 August 2023 08.04 > > > >

RE: [RFC] lib/st_ring: add single thread ring

2023-08-22 Thread Honnappa Nagarahalli
> >> Subject: Re: [RFC] lib/st_ring: add single thread ring > >> > >> On 2023-08-21 08:04, Honnappa Nagarahalli wrote: > >>> Add a single thread safe and multi-thread unsafe ring data structure. > >> > >> One must have set the bar ver

Re: [RFC] lib/st_ring: add single thread ring

2023-08-22 Thread Mattias Rönnblom
Vithanage ; nd Subject: Re: [RFC] lib/st_ring: add single thread ring On 2023-08-21 08:04, Honnappa Nagarahalli wrote: Add a single thread safe and multi-thread unsafe ring data structure. One must have set the bar very low, if one needs to specify that an API is single-thread safe. This library

RE: [RFC] lib/st_ring: add single thread ring

2023-08-21 Thread Honnappa Nagarahalli
> Subject: RE: [RFC] lib/st_ring: add single thread ring > > > From: Honnappa Nagarahalli [mailto:honnappa.nagaraha...@arm.com] > > Sent: Monday, 21 August 2023 08.04 > > > > Add a single thread safe and multi-thread unsafe ring data structure. > > This l

RE: [RFC] lib/st_ring: add single thread ring

2023-08-21 Thread Honnappa Nagarahalli
> Subject: Re: [RFC] lib/st_ring: add single thread ring > > On 2023-08-21 08:04, Honnappa Nagarahalli wrote: > > Add a single thread safe and multi-thread unsafe ring data structure. > > One must have set the bar very low, if one needs to specify that an API is > single-thr

Re: [RFC] lib/st_ring: add single thread ring

2023-08-21 Thread Mattias Rönnblom
On 2023-08-21 08:04, Honnappa Nagarahalli wrote: Add a single thread safe and multi-thread unsafe ring data structure. One must have set the bar very low, if one needs to specify that an API is single-thread safe. This library provides an simple and efficient alternative to multi-thread saf

RE: [RFC] lib/st_ring: add single thread ring

2023-08-21 Thread Morten Brørup
> From: Honnappa Nagarahalli [mailto:honnappa.nagaraha...@arm.com] > Sent: Monday, 21 August 2023 08.04 > > Add a single thread safe and multi-thread unsafe ring data structure. > This library provides an simple and efficient alternative to multi- > thread > safe ring when multi-thread safety is n

[RFC] lib/st_ring: add single thread ring

2023-08-20 Thread Honnappa Nagarahalli
Add a single thread safe and multi-thread unsafe ring data structure. This library provides an simple and efficient alternative to multi-thread safe ring when multi-thread safety is not required. Signed-off-by: Honnappa Nagarahalli --- v1: 1) The code is very prelimnary and is not even compiled 2